Working steps
Pick one workflow.
Write 3-5 metrics.
Add baseline and target.
Confirm measurability inside the pilot window.
Get written buyer agreement.
Filled example (fictional — warehouse)
Three criteria that survive a CFO review.
| Metric | Baseline | Target | Measured how | Owner |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Median cycle-count time | 4.0 h | ≤1.0 h | Time stamps in product + spot audits | Priya |
| Weekly unprompted completion | n/a | ≥80% of named users | Product analytics | You + Priya |
| Inventory variance (500 SKU) | 3.2% | ≤1.5% | Finance-agreed sample method | Marcus / finance |
